Structured, balanced and medium-bodied, this is an old-fashioned style St Emilion well-worthy of Grand Cru status, even though it's actually the second wine of the estate!

Flavours of bramble, berry and developing cedar and some leather spice are delivered on the gently pushy palate, making this a wine fit for excellent food or even very little.

It's now from the underrated 2013 vintage and it is a mark of the property's honour that in this more challenging vintage, the main Chateau wine was reduced in output, meaning that the fruit normally destined for its use was incorporated into this blend, the second wine of the estate! This is the very closest many of us will bet to the Cru Classe itself. 

Dating from the late eighteenth century, Chateau Bellefont-Belcier, the parent property, is at the north of the St. Emilion zone, where it makes Grand Cru Classé wines. Its name allegedly comes from Belle Fontaine, meaning 'beautiful spring’ (a reference to the numerous springs near the property) and to its founder, the Marquis of Belcier. The Marquis de Bellefont is a suitable elision of the two, turned around.
